MC Question 2

The Fruit Company (F Co) currently grows fruit which customers pick themselves from the fields before paying. F Co is concerned that a large number of customers are eating some of the fruit whilst picking it and are therefore not paying for all of it. As a result, it has to decide whether to hire staff to pick and package the fruit instead. The following values and costs have been identified:

(i)  The total sales value of the fruit currently picked and paid for by customers 
(ii)  The cost of growing the fruit
(iii) The cost of hiring staff to pick and package the fruit
(iv) The total sales value of the fruit if it is picked and packaged by staff instead

Which of the above are relevant to the decision?

A. All of the above
B. (ii), (iii) and (iv) only
C. (i), (ii) and (iv) only
D. (i), (iii) and (iv) only
